Before You Pick Either County

A comparison page should narrow the search, not end it. Use this checklist to turn the county match into a parcel-specific call list and due-diligence plan.

Planning call questions
01

Confirm jurisdiction

Ask whether the parcel is handled by unincorporated county staff, a city, a subdivision, a special district, or another authority before relying on either Klickitat County or Okanogan County score.

02

Verify intended use

Describe the exact plan: tiny home, RV stay, manufactured home, container build, cabin, ADU, garden, livestock, or off-grid system.

03

Check land basics

Confirm legal access, road maintenance, slope, floodplain, wildfire exposure, title issues, easements, covenants, and whether utilities are nearby.

04

Price the hard systems

Water, septic, driveway, power, winter access, grading, and permitting costs can change the better county once you move from county-level research to a real parcel.

RV Living

Long-term RV or camper occupancy in Klickitat County should be confirmed directly with county planning or code staff. Verify camping-duration limits, temporary-use permits, sanitation, water, utility service, driveway access, and whether rules differ inside cities or subdivisions.

Off Grid

Off-grid projects in Klickitat County should verify county land-use review, building-permit requirements, Washington well rules, septic feasibility, legal access, road maintenance, wildfire exposure, floodplain, slope, and emergency-response constraints.

Water and Septic

Water availability in Klickitat County is parcel-specific. Check well feasibility, water rights, groundwater conditions, hauled-water feasibility, source-protection zones, and subdivision requirements before purchase.

Septic or onsite wastewater feasibility in Klickitat County requires parcel-level review through the local health jurisdiction and Washington onsite sewage rules, including soils, setbacks, groundwater, slope, and water-source separation.

RV Living

Long-term RV or camper occupancy in Okanogan County should be confirmed directly with county planning or code staff. Verify camping-duration limits, temporary-use permits, sanitation, water, utility service, driveway access, and whether rules differ inside cities or subdivisions.

Off Grid

Off-grid projects in Okanogan County should verify county land-use review, building-permit requirements, Washington well rules, septic feasibility, legal access, road maintenance, wildfire exposure, floodplain, slope, and emergency-response constraints.

Water and Septic

Water availability in Okanogan County is parcel-specific. Check well feasibility, water rights, groundwater conditions, hauled-water feasibility, source-protection zones, and subdivision requirements before purchase. Washington Ecology water-right, water-right search, and well resources are important first-pass checks for private-water feasibility.

Septic or onsite wastewater feasibility in Okanogan County requires parcel-level review through the local health jurisdiction and Washington onsite sewage rules, including soils, setbacks, groundwater, slope, and water-source separation. Washington DOH onsite sewage rules and local health-jurisdiction review remain required before relying on any rural parcel.
